About Invisalign

Invisalign is an aligner system that uses a sequence of custom-made plastic aligners to re-position and align the teeth. Invisalign aligners are made from clear plastic and slide onto your teeth. Once they are sat in place, it is virtually impossible for other people to detect them.

Invisalign works differently to traditional braces and uses multiple appliances, rather than a single orthodontic device. Each aligner is worn for 2 weeks and the sequence follows until treatment is complete.

As well as offering virtual invisibility, Invisalign also offers patients:

  • comfort: the aligners generate gentle forces and there are no metal parts
  • convenience: Invisalign aligners are removable, so they fit into your normal day to day life very easily. You won’t have to adapt the way you eat, the foods you buy or the way you clean your teeth
  • improved oral health: braces can be notoriously hard to clean, but with Invisalign, there is no added risk of decay as you remove your aligners to brush your teeth
  • confidence: many people worry about having braces because they think they look unattractive or affect the way other people view them. With Invisalign, you can go through the process without any worries at all about what you look like or how you come across to other people

How to Clean Your Braces During Treatment

Thursday, June 25th, 2015

3943593_blogWhen you have braces, you have to be particularly mindful of oral hygiene, as there is a greater risk of food debris getting trapped in the mouth and subsequently an elevated risk of decay. When you have braces fitted, your dentist will explain how to keep them clean and which foods to try and avoid to protect your braces and promote good oral health and show you some effective cleaning techniques.

Keeping braces clean

If you have fixed braces, it can be tricky to keep them clean, especially after eating. But once you get used to a cleaning regime, you will find it becomes second nature and you should have no problems at all. If you are struggling at any point, don’t hesitate to get in touch and our dentists will be happy to help.

We recommend brushing the teeth after meals, but it is best to wait around 40 minutes. You can use a normal toothbrush and there are also specially designed brushes you can use for braces. We also recommend rinsing with mouthwash to wash away bacteria and food particles.

Dental checks

In addition to a good oral hygiene routine, we also recommend regular dental checks throughout your treatment so we can see how you are getting on and give your teeth a good clean and polish. If you have any problems at all between scheduled checks, we are always at the end of the phone to arrange extra appointments.

Diet

Your diet is really important when it comes to oral health and this is especially pertinent if you have braces. There are some foods that increase the risk of decay and gum disease and there are also some foods that may cause problems for your brace, such as boiled sweets and other hard foods. Generally speaking, it’s best to try and stick to a healthy, balanced diet, avoid chewy and sticky foods and moderate sugar intake.

What exactly is Invisalign?

Invisalign is a popular modern orthodontic system, which is designed to offer a discreet, convenient and flexible alternative to fixed braces. With Invisalign, clients receive a set of custom-designed appliances, known as aligners; these aligners are shaped to allow room for movement and they generate forces, which gently guide the teeth into position.

Invisalign is a versatile treatment and it is suitable for many patients; it is an excellent choice for people who are conscious of their image and those who have to maintain a certain look for work purposes and it can also be really beneficial for people who are worried about what others will say or think about them wearing braces. Invisalign aligners are made from clear plastic and they slide onto the teeth; they are virtually undetectable when you speak and smile.

What happens when you have treatment?

After the consultation stage, you will receive your custom-made Invisalign aligners. The aligners are designed to be worn in a set order and each one should be worn for 2 weeks. Invisalign aligners afford your flexibility and simplicity, as they can be removed when you eat and brush your teeth; this means that you can continue to eat and clean your teeth in exactly the same way as you did before you started treatment.

Invisalign aligners should be worn for at least 22 hours per day to ensure good results. During the treatment process, your City Dental dentist will arrange frequent check-ups to monitor the progress of your treatment.

What is Invisalign?

Invisalign is an innovative removable brace system, which offers a discreet and convenient alternative to traditional metal fixed braces. Rather than wearing a fixed brace for months, patients wear a series of specially made removable aligners, which are made from clear plastic. Each aligner is different and all are worn for a fortnight.

Invisalign Teen is the same as Invisalign but it offers additional benefits designed especially for teenagers. There are spare aligners available and the aligners are marked with coloured indicators to remind patients when to swap their brace for the next in the series.

Invisalign is a great option for younger patients who are worried about the impact of wearing a brace on their looks and what other people may say about them having treatment.
